    Choosing The Right Thermal Grease

    Choosing the right thermal grease is important for your CPU’s health and performance. Thermal grease helps transfer heat from the CPU to the cooler. Good thermal grease keeps your CPU cooler and runs smoother. Using the wrong type can cause overheating or damage. Understanding types, factors, and brands helps pick the best option for your setup.

    Types Of Thermal Grease

    There are several types of thermal grease. Silicone-based grease is common and easy to use. It offers good heat transfer and lasts long. Metal-based grease contains tiny metal particles. It has excellent heat conductivity but can be slightly conductive electrically. Ceramic-based grease uses ceramic particles. It is safe and non-conductive but may not transfer heat as well as metal-based. Liquid metal thermal paste offers the best heat transfer but is tricky to apply and can damage some parts.

    Factors To Consider

    Choose thermal grease with good thermal conductivity. This lets heat flow efficiently from CPU to cooler. Check if the paste is electrically non-conductive for safety. Look for ease of application, especially if you are new. Consider how long the paste lasts before drying out. Some pastes need reapplying after a few years. Compatibility with your CPU and cooler also matters. Avoid pastes that can cause corrosion or damage to parts.

    Recommended Brands

    Arctic Silver 5 is a popular metal-based thermal paste. It balances performance and safety well. Noctua NT-H1 is a ceramic-based paste that is easy to spread. It works well for most users and lasts long. Thermal Grizzly Kryonaut is a top choice for high performance. It suits overclockers and heavy users. Cooler Master MasterGel is budget-friendly and reliable. It fits most everyday builds and provides good cooling.

    Preparing The Cpu Surface

    Preparing the CPU surface is a key step before applying thermal grease. A clean, smooth surface helps the thermal paste spread evenly. This ensures better heat transfer between the CPU and the cooler. Proper preparation avoids overheating and keeps your PC running well.

    Cleaning Old Thermal Paste

    Start by removing old thermal paste from the CPU. Use a soft cloth or paper towel with isopropyl alcohol. Gently wipe the surface until no residue remains. Avoid using water or harsh chemicals. Take your time to clean every corner carefully.

    Ensuring A Dust-free Surface

    Dust can stop thermal paste from sticking properly. Use a clean, dry cloth to remove any dust or particles. Avoid touching the CPU surface with your fingers after cleaning. Keep the area free from dirt before applying new thermal grease.

    Methods Of Applying Thermal Grease

    Applying thermal grease correctly is key for good CPU cooling. The thermal grease fills tiny gaps between the CPU and the cooler. This helps heat move from the CPU to the cooler quickly. There are different ways to apply thermal grease. Each method has its own benefits. Choose one that fits your comfort and the type of cooler you use.

    Pea-sized Dot Method

    Put a small dot of thermal grease, about the size of a pea, in the center of the CPU. When you place the cooler on top, the grease spreads evenly. This method is simple and reduces the chance of air bubbles. It works well for most CPUs and coolers.

    Line Method

    Apply a thin line of thermal grease across the middle of the CPU. This method helps spread the grease in one direction. It is useful for rectangular CPUs or coolers with a similar shape. The line spreads out when the cooler is pressed down, covering the surface.

    Spread Method

    Use a small tool or a plastic card to spread the thermal grease evenly across the CPU surface. This method ensures full coverage without gaps. It takes more time but gives control over the thickness. Avoid using too much grease; a thin layer works best.

    Installing The Cpu Cooler

    Installing the CPU cooler is a key step after applying thermal grease. The cooler helps keep the CPU temperature low. Proper installation ensures good contact between the cooler and CPU. This contact allows heat to transfer efficiently. Poor installation can cause overheating and damage. Follow clear steps for a solid setup.

    Aligning The Cooler Properly

    Place the cooler so it matches the CPU socket. Check the orientation of the mounting brackets. Make sure the cooler’s base covers the thermal grease fully. Avoid shifting the cooler once it touches the grease. A good fit prevents air pockets and keeps heat moving.

    Securing With Even Pressure

    Fasten the cooler screws in a cross pattern. Tighten each screw a little at a time. This keeps pressure balanced on all sides. Too much force on one corner can crack the CPU or motherboard. Even pressure spreads the thermal grease evenly for better cooling.

    Common Mistakes To Avoid

    Applying thermal grease to your CPU might seem easy. Yet, small errors can cause big problems. These mistakes reduce the cooling efficiency and can harm your processor. Avoid these common errors for better performance and longer CPU life.

    Using Too Much Or Too Little Paste

    Using too much thermal paste creates thick layers. This blocks heat transfer and causes higher temperatures. On the other hand, too little paste leaves gaps. Air pockets form, reducing contact between surfaces. Apply a small, pea-sized amount in the center. The pressure will spread it evenly when you attach the cooler.

    Skipping Surface Preparation

    Clean the CPU and cooler surfaces before applying paste. Dust, old paste, or grease stops proper contact. Use isopropyl alcohol and a soft cloth to clean both surfaces. Let them dry completely. Skipping this step leads to poor heat transfer and unstable CPU temperatures.

    Testing Cooling Performance

    Testing cooling performance is a key step after applying thermal grease to your CPU. It helps ensure your processor stays cool and runs smoothly. Without testing, you cannot know if the thermal grease spread is effective. This process involves checking temperatures and making adjustments if needed. Proper testing protects your CPU from overheating and damage.

    Monitoring Cpu Temperatures

    Start by turning on your computer and opening a temperature monitoring tool. Many free programs show real-time CPU temperatures. Watch the temperature while the CPU is idle and under load. Idle means the computer is doing little work. Load means running a heavy program or stress test. Temperatures should stay within safe limits, usually below 80°C. If temperatures rise quickly, the thermal grease may not be applied well.

    Adjusting Application If Needed

    High temperatures mean it is time to reapply thermal grease. Turn off the computer and remove the heatsink carefully. Clean off the old thermal grease using isopropyl alcohol and a lint-free cloth. Apply a new, thin layer of thermal grease evenly on the CPU surface. Reattach the heatsink firmly but gently. Repeat the temperature test to check for improvement. Proper application lowers the CPU temperature and improves cooling performance.

    Frequently Asked Questions

    What Is Thermal Grease And Why Use It On A Cpu?

    Thermal grease improves heat transfer between the CPU and cooler. It fills microscopic gaps, enhancing cooling efficiency and preventing overheating.

    How Much Thermal Grease Should I Apply On My Cpu?

    Apply a small, pea-sized amount of thermal grease at the CPU center. Too much or too little can reduce cooling performance.

    Can I Reuse Thermal Grease When Replacing My Cpu Cooler?

    No, always clean off old thermal grease and apply fresh paste. Reusing can cause poor heat transfer and damage your CPU.

    How Do I Clean Old Thermal Grease From A Cpu?

    Use isopropyl alcohol and a lint-free cloth to gently remove old grease. Make sure the surface is fully dry before applying new paste.
